Careful with this change to Relaypost's compaction loop. Lowering the segment-merge threshold helps reclaim disk faster, but it also increases I/O pressure during peak hours, which is exactly when the Tarnwell cluster already runs hot. If compaction falls behind, consumers will see stale tombstones, so please watch the lag dashboard after deploy and be ready to roll back. I've pulled the relevant knobs into one place so on-call can reason about them together. The values I'm proposing are these.

limits module of yadug-bahip:
QUOTAS = {
    "oliath": 10,
    "holath": 5,
}

## Data Stores — Digest Scheduling

Welcome aboard. The Mailforge digest scheduler keeps its state in a dedicated database, separate from the message queue. Each row in `digest_runs` records the window boundaries and delivery status; never edit these by hand, since the scheduler uses them to avoid double-sends. Retention is ninety days, enforced by a nightly job. Before running any scheduler command locally, verify your environment is pointed at the sandbox store using the connection string provided below.

primary connection of tawif-yajeg = postgresql://rusiel_svc:G879q9cx6GsSvj@db-dd9f.norvagrid.internal:5432/casath

MINUTES — Management Meeting (Sales Leads)

Quick recap: we agreed to renew the Tolver & Mace packaging contract for two years. Pricing holds flat, delivery windows tighten to 48 hours. Dana from procurement handles paperwork; sales leads should flag any client-facing impacts by Friday. Confidential note on wider plans appears below:

board note of bawep-tajef: Queniusek Systems plans to raise the Quenvan list price by 53.1 percent in March. The pricing group signed off on a budget of $176.4 million for Project Drueth. The renewal with Casionix Partners closes at $142.5 million a year, 8.3 percent below the last contract. Project Fraax slips by six weeks because of the tooling delay.

Quarterly Planning Note — Launch of Mirelet Pro

Finance team: the Mirelet Pro launch is scheduled for week eleven of the quarter. Please model cash impact of the staged tooling payments, the deferred channel rebates, and the Norvale warehouse ramp. Sensitivity cases should cover a two-week slip. A confidential planning assumption follows, restricted to this distribution.

management briefing: Headcount on the Wenael team goes from 5 to 140 by the end of July. Gross margin on Wenael came in at 20 percent against a plan of 15 percent.